VHCC vs. Chester Career
Both Virginia Highlands Community College and Chester Career College are 2-4 years schools located in Virginia. The following statements compare Virginia Highlands Community College and Chester Career College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Chester Career's tuition ($36,500) is more expensive than VHCC ($10,866).
- Chester Career's students to faculty ratio (14 to 1) is lower than VHCC (18 to 1).
- VHCC (2,052 students) is larger than Chester Career (147 students) with more enrolled students.
- Chester Career ($5,303) has higher amount of financial aid than VHCC ($5,058).
- VHCC's graduation rate (42%) is higher than Chester Career (40%).
